Medical Accounting Software Market was valued at USD 3.5 Billion in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 7.1 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 9.8% from 2024 to 2030.
The Medical Accounting Software Market has seen significant growth over recent years, driven by the increasing need for efficient financial management and the growing number of healthcare providers worldwide. These software solutions are tailored to meet the unique requirements of the healthcare industry, including billing, accounting, and auditing, as well as handling insurance claims and payments. Medical accounting software helps healthcare organizations streamline their financial processes, reduce human errors, and enhance financial reporting accuracy. The market has witnessed an expanding demand from both large healthcare enterprises and small and medium-sized healthcare providers. This software is not only used by hospitals and clinics but also by pharmaceutical companies, insurance companies, and healthcare consultants. As the healthcare industry continues to evolve, medical accounting software solutions are expected to play a critical role in supporting financial sustainability and improving operational efficiency.

The Medical Accounting Software Market can be segmented by application, which is crucial in understanding the specific needs of different healthcare entities. In the healthcare sector, the application of medical accounting software extends to managing billing and coding, monitoring financial transactions, performing audits, and ensuring compliance with industry regulations. These applications are designed to automate several complex processes, reducing administrative burdens, improving accuracy, and enabling organizations to meet regulatory requirements efficiently. The growing adoption of medical accounting software across various healthcare organizations is expected to continue as the healthcare industry embraces digitalization and looks for solutions to improve financial transparency and cost management.
Small and Medium Enterprises (SMEs) in the healthcare sector are increasingly turning to medical accounting software to meet their financial management needs. These organizations require solutions that are affordable, scalable, and easy to implement. Medical accounting software for SMEs typically offers a range of functionalities, including invoicing, expense tracking, and financial reporting, all tailored to the specific requirements of smaller healthcare providers. The software allows SMEs to manage their finances more effectively and make informed decisions, even with limited resources. Additionally, the growing focus on improving operational efficiencies within these enterprises, coupled with rising healthcare costs, further drives the adoption of these solutions among SMEs in the healthcare industry.
Large healthcare enterprises, such as hospitals, healthcare networks, and insurance companies, require robust and highly scalable medical accounting software to handle their complex financial systems. These organizations typically have larger volumes of financial data to process, making it essential for the software to provide advanced features such as multi-currency management, integrated billing systems, and sophisticated reporting capabilities. The needs of large enterprises in the healthcare sector often include full automation of accounting processes, compliance management, and real-time financial monitoring to support decision-making at a strategic level. These enterprises often invest in customized solutions or premium software packages that can be tailored to their specific workflows, regulations, and reporting standards.
Several key trends are shaping the growth of the medical accounting software market. One of the most significant trends is the increasing demand for cloud-based software solutions. Cloud technology provides healthcare organizations with flexibility, scalability, and cost savings, making it an attractive option for managing accounting functions. Cloud-based software also enables healthcare providers to access their financial data anytime and from anywhere, which is particularly beneficial for multi-location healthcare systems and remote teams. Another notable trend is the growing integ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) technologies within medical accounting software. These technologies help automate routine tasks, detect financial anomalies, and enhance predictive analytics, which can significantly improve decision-making processes in healthcare organizations.
Another important trend in the medical accounting software market is the increasing focus on data security and compliance. As healthcare organizations handle sensitive patient data and financial information, protecting this data from breaches and ensuring compliance with regulations such as HIPAA and GDPR is critical. As a result, medical accounting software providers are increasingly prioritizing security features, such as encryption, secure user authentication, and regular software updates. Additionally, the integration of blockchain technology is gaining attention in the healthcare industry for its potential to improve the transparency, security, and efficiency of financial transactions, further driving innovation in the medical accounting software sector.

What is medical accounting software used for?
Medical accounting software is used to manage financial processes, including billing, invoicing, reporting, and compliance in healthcare organizations.
How does medical accounting software help healthcare providers?
It helps healthcare providers streamline financial operations, reduce errors, improve reporting accuracy, and ensure compliance with industry regulations.
Is medical accounting software customizable for different healthcare sectors?
Yes, many medical accounting software solutions can be tailored to meet the unique needs of various healthcare sectors, such as hospitals, clinics, and insurance companies.
What are the benefits of cloud-based medical accounting software?
Cloud-based software offers flexibility, scalability, and cost savings, allowing healthcare organizations to access their financial data remotely and securely.
How secure is medical accounting software?
Medical accounting software is typically equipped with advanced security features, such as encryption and secure authentication, to protect sensitive financial and patient data.
Can small healthcare organizations use medical accounting software?
Yes, medical accounting software is available for small healthcare organizations, providing affordable solutions to meet their financial management needs.
Does medical accounting software help with insurance claims?
Yes, medical accounting software often includes tools to manage insurance claims, track payments, and ensure that reimbursements are processed correctly.
What is the future of medical accounting software?
The future of medical accounting software includes greater automation, integration with AI, and enhanced data security to meet the evolving needs of the healthcare sector.
What factors drive the growth of the medical accounting software market?
The growth of the medical accounting software market is driven by increasing digitalization in healthcare, the need for cost-effective solutions, and regulatory compliance requirements.
Can medical accounting software integrate with other healthcare systems?
Yes, most medical accounting software solutions are designed to integrate with other healthcare systems, such as electronic health records (EHR) and practice management systems.
